question 2
protrusion of an organ through its natural wall is known as:
a reflux.
b perforation.
c volvulus.
d diverticulosis.
e hernia.
Brief Explanations
To solve this, we analyze each option:
- Option A: Reflux is the backflow of a fluid, not organ protrusion.
- Option B: Perforation is a hole or rupture, not protrusion.
- Option C: Volvulus is a twisting of an organ, not protrusion.
- Option D: Diverticulosis is the presence of diverticula (small pouches), not protrusion through the wall.
- Option E: Hernia is defined as the protrusion of an organ through its natural wall.
